(2x - 9) (x + 4) = 0 What the answer

Mathematics
2 answers:
natta225 [31]3 years ago
6 0

Answer:

x = 9/2 and x = -4

Step-by-step explanation:

you can set each expression in the parenthesis' equal to zero. this is due to it being multiplication so if one parenthesis equals 0, the answer will be 0

2x - 9 = 0 and x + 4 = 0

starting with 2x-9=0

add 9 to both sides

2x = 9

divide by 2

x = 9/2

then do x + 4 = 0

subtract 4

x = -4

so your two answers are

x = 9/2 and x = -4
